What is a LCSW?
LCSW stands for certified medical social worker. They are social workers who have gone on to obtain their master’s in social work (MSW) and finish the requirements in their state to acquire their professional license. By getting their MSW and license, they can work in a variety of environments, check out different expertises, and even open up their own private practice.

What does a Licensed Scientific Social Worker Do?
A licensed clinical social worker offers treatment to clients with psychological and psychological issuesExternal link: open_in_new that are affecting their lives. They deal with their customers to listen to their requirements and provide the support and resources needed to cope with those problems.

LCSWs also have the capability to diagnose and treat the problems of their customers, although this might differ by state. This can be in the form of supplying treatment, supplying referrals, and working with other professionals like physicians to come up with an effective treatment plan for their customer.

Where do LCSWs work?
LCSWs can work in a variety of settings. Some work in offices for research functions, and others may visit their customers in schools, their house, recreation center, hospitals, assisted living centers, and more. The work environment of an LCSW differs depending on their area of specialization.

Is a LCSW thought about a physician?
LCSWs have the capability to offer psychiatric therapy to their clients, however, their training focuses on connecting their clients with the resources and abilities required to meet their needs. LCSWs can easily work together with psychiatrists and physicians to establish comprehensive treatment strategies for clients.

While those in the field of psychiatry can go on to medical school and earn their Physician of Medication, the master’s in social work (MSW) is the highest level of education that LCSWs acquire. Depending on an LCSW’s profession objectives, they might choose to complete a DSW program down the line.

How much does a LCSW make?
As of May 2020, the typical annual wage for social workers was $51,760 External link: open_in_new, according to the BLS. The salary of an LCSW varies based on aspects such as their company, specialty, and the amount of time they work. Lots of social workers tend to work full-time, but some might be on call.

A psychologist is a social researcher who is trained to study human habits and psychological procedures. Psychologists can work in a range of research study or clinical settings.

PhD programs in scientific psychology stress theory and research study methods and prepare students for either academic work or careers as specialists. The PsyD, which was developed in the late 1960s to resolve a lack of professionals, stresses training in therapy and counseling. Psychologists with either degree can practice treatment however are required to complete a number of years of monitored practice prior to ending up being licensed.

A psychologist will identify a mental illness or issue and determine what’s best for the client’s care. A psychologist frequently works in tandem with a psychiatrist, who is also a medical doctor and can recommend medication if it is determined that medication is required for a patient’s treatment. Psychologists can do research, which is a really crucial contribution academically and clinically, to the profession.
